Why Rent a Car at Split Airport?
Split Airport (SPU), officially Zračna luka Split, is located in Kaštela, approximately 24 km from Split city center. It serves as the main gateway to Central Dalmatia and the Croatian islands. Hiring a car directly at the airport gives you immediate freedom to explore:
- Split — UNESCO-listed Diocletian's Palace and vibrant waterfront
- Trogir — Medieval UNESCO town, just 5 km from the airport
- Makarska Riviera — Stunning beaches and coastal resorts
- Krka & Plitvice — National parks with breathtaking waterfalls
- Hvar & Brač — Ferry ports accessible by car

Meet & Greet Service at SPU Airport
Many local suppliers at Split Airport offer meet and greet service. After you collect your luggage, a company representative will be waiting in the arrivals hall holding a sign with your name. They will escort you to the car, complete the paperwork on-site, and hand over the keys — no shuttle bus, no waiting.

Driving from Split Airport
The airport is well-connected via the D8 coastal road and the A1 motorway:
- To Split: 25–30 minutes via D409 and D8
- To Trogir: 5–10 minutes via D409
- To Makarska: 1 hour via D8 coastal road
- To Zadar: 1.5 hours via A1 motorway
- To Dubrovnik: 3 hours via A1 and D8
Roads are well-maintained. Tolls apply on the A1 motorway. GPS or offline maps are recommended for rural areas.

Tips for Renting a Car at Split Airport
- Book early: Prices rise and availability drops in July–August
- Check insurance: Many no-deposit deals include full coverage (CDW + Theft + additional)
- Inspect the car: Document existing damage with photos before leaving the lot
- Fuel policy: Most rentals are Full-to-Full (return with a full tank)
- Tolls & parking: Keep coins/cards for motorway tolls; Split old town has limited parking
- Border crossings: If traveling to Bosnia or Montenegro, confirm cross-border permission with the supplier

Do I need an International Driving Permit for Croatia?
If your license is from an EU country, the UK, USA, Canada, Australia, or New Zealand, your national license is sufficient. For other countries, an IDP may be required.
Can I rent a car at Split Airport without a credit card?
Some no-deposit suppliers accept debit cards or cash. Filter by "No Deposit" in our widget and check individual supplier terms.
What is the minimum age to rent a car in Croatia?
Usually 21 years old with at least 2 years of driving experience. Drivers under 25 may incur a young driver surcharge.

About Split Airport (SPU)
Split Airport (IATA: SPU, ICAO: LDSP) is the third busiest airport in Croatia, handling over 3 million passengers annually. It serves major European cities with seasonal and year-round flights from Ryanair, easyJet, Croatia Airlines, Eurowings, and more.
The airport is modern, with a single terminal building featuring:
- Cafés, restaurants, and duty-free shops
- Currency exchange and ATMs
- Free Wi-Fi
- Tourist information desk
